✨🐻 Step into the Teddy Bear’s Garden at Perth Cultural Centre as part of AWESOME Festival 2025! 🐻✨
Fun and creativity await in the enchanting Teddy Bear's Garden, where the Urban Orchard comes alive with whimsical teddy bear-themed creative activities for children and their adults as part of the 2025 AWESOME Festival.
πŸ“… When: 10am – 3pm daily, 30 September – 4 October 2025
πŸ“ Where: Urban Orchard, Perth Cultural Centre
πŸŽͺ Part of the 2025 AWESOME Festival
πŸ’Έ FREE events
🎨 Messy Bears (Under 5)
Our Big Bears love messy art so help us decorate them. Paint, collage and draw on our bears. Then take some time to make quiet art in our squishy corner. Draw small bears and sculpt teeny, tiny, bears from clay. A joyful space for children under 5 to express themselves.
🧡 Crafty Bears (Ages 4+)
Get crafty with textile artist Annick Akanni and discover the magic of textile art in this bear-themed creative space. Come along and learn new skills and explore creative textile techniques.
🍰 Teddy Bear’s Tea Party (Ages 3+)
Join artist Kate Page for an enchanting Teddy Bear's Tea Party in the Tea Party Marquee! Children are encouraged to bring their teddy bears or cuddly friends for creative adventures and unforgettable fun with their grown-ups.
🎢 Uptown Brown (All Ages)
Uptown Brown is a singing gentleman-adventurer performing a program of primitive 1920s-1930s jazz and blues on a self-invented one-man band. His contraption is built from cedar, leather, and brass, whilst vocals & fingerpicked ukulele are amplified through old megaphones, mimicking the effect of a 78 record.
πŸ› Kids’ Markets (All Ages)
The AWESOME Kids' Markets are back! The next generation of local young creatives and entrepreneurs have been busy creating a vast array of homemade creations which they'll have on sale throughout the festival. Come along and check out all the glorious goods on offer.
πŸ’­ Your AWESOME Moment (All Ages)
Share your AWESOME moment! Visit our bright red "wishing line" and tell us what made the Festival special for you. Write or draw your favourite memory, feeling, or story, then hang it up to join a colourful display of the joy, wonder, and creativity we've shared together.
πŸ’‘ The Change Maker Tent (All Ages)
Kids' Voices Matter!
They have big ideas, kind hearts and strong voices. When they speak up about what's fair, what's kind, or what needs fixing, grown-ups listen. That's what the Change Maker Tent is all about - helping children to use their voice to make the world better.
Join us in a welcoming space to explore an important issue facing lots of West Australians, you'll find the tools to speak out against poverty in WA and join in a simple but powerful way to be part of the solution.
πŸŽ€ Ribbon Dancing (All Ages)
Key Assets believes all children and young people deserve to thrive and connect to family, community, and culture, and have opportunities to express themselves through the arts. Join Key Assets for a joyful ribbon dancing experience! Children will receive their own ribbon and learn basic figures including spirals, circles, and snakes. This engaging activity encourages imagination, creative self-expression, and develops coordination and flexibility.
🚌 The Feetbus (All Ages)
A box on bicycle wheels disguised as a bus, the Feetbus invites 15 to 20 "passengers" to climb aboard and join the fun. Once on board, they become instant performers, signalling turns with their arms, beeping when reversing and sometimes breaking into song or playful antics led by the driver. Equal parts spectacle and silliness, the Feetbus turns its passengers into entertainers and its audience into delighted onlookers, making the simple act of catching a ride an unforgettable comedy of movement.
